Draw a representation (using Lewis Structures) showing the strongest of these interaction. There are 2 steps to solve this one.The boiling point of Methanol ( CH3OH) is 64.7 °C. The melting point of Methanol is -97.6 °C. The molecular weight of Methanol is 32.04 g/mol. It is a polar solvent and is also known as wood alcohol because it was once produced by the distillation of wood. The smell of this compound is on the sweeter side as compared to ethanol.B. Polar molecules are asymmetric, either containing lone pairs of electrons on a central atom ...May 22, 2023 · Lewis structure of CH3OH (or Methanol) contains three C-H bonds, one O-H bond and one C-O bond. The Carbon atom (C) is at the center and it is surrounded by 3 Hydrogen atoms (H) and one OH group. The oxygen atom has 2 lone pairs. Let’s draw and understand this lewis dot structure step by step. I also go over hybridization, shape, sigma, pi bonding and bond angles.Methanol is a promising energy carrier because, as a liquid, it is easier to store than hydrogen and natural gas. Its energy density is, however, lower than methane, per kg. Its combustion energy density is 15.6 MJ / L ( LHV ), whereas that of ethanol is 24 and gasoline is 33 MJ/L.
